How they compare
Guinea-Bissau currently reports 90.0% against 89.0% in Colombia, a difference of 1.0%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 18 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Guinea-Bissau ahead.
Colombia ranks 72nd and Guinea-Bissau ranks 70th of 194 countries.
Colombia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Colombia | Guinea-Bissau |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 0.0% | 0.0% | 0.0% | — |
| 2010s | 78.6% | 34.1% | 44.5% | Colombia |
| 2020s | 88.0% | 85.5% | 2.5% | Colombia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
